Michael Polansky is opening up about his wedding planning progress with Lady Gaga.
For Gaga’s Rolling Stone cover story published on Thursday, Nov. 13, Polansky spoke to the magazine about his pop superstar fiancée, and made a rare comment about their upcoming wedding.
“We’re talking about it all the time,” Polansky said. “We have these breaks, and they’re tempting. It’s like, ‘Okay, can we get married that weekend?’ We don’t want a really big wedding, but we want to enjoy it. In a lot of ways, we already feel married, so it’s not like it’s gonna change much.”

According to the outlet, the couple is planning on tying the knot “soon,” either during Gaga’s The Mayhem Ball tour or just after. The tour began earlier this year in July in Las Vegas, and is scheduled to conclude in April 2026 in New York City.
Gaga, 39, and Polansky, 42, approached tour planning together. “Imagine two best friends just moving through life, but we’re always being creative,” the Joker actress told Rolling Stone.
After marriage will be parenthood.
“Being a mom is the thing I want the most,” Gaga said. “And he’s gonna be a beautiful father. We’re really excited about that.”
Elsewhere in the interview, Gaga shared that she’s comfortable being her complete self with her fiancé, who she confirmed her engagement to in 2024. “Being in love with someone that cares about the real me made a very big difference.”

The “Poker Face” singer and the entrepreneur have been romantically linked since they were photographed kissing at a 2020 New Year’s Eve party in Las Vegas. The duo went public with their relationship after spending a PDA-packed weekend together in Miami for Super Bowl 2020.

Gaga sparked engagement rumors in April 2024 when she was spotted wearing a massive diamond ring. She later confirmed the rumors to be true when she introduced Polansky as her “fiancé” at the Paris Olympics in July 2024.
Speaking to Vogue for an October 2024 cover story, Gaga revealed that Polansky popped the question while the two were rock climbing together.
The A Star Is Born actress also told the magazine that she was “so happy” in her relationship.
“I had never met anyone like Michael,” she gushed. “He’s so smart and so kind. And his life and my life are very different. He’s a very private guy and he’s not with me for any other reason than that we are right for each other.”
